Del Littorio

Hi - Our Dobes are from Del Littorio, in Snohomish, Washington. Roberto Zorzi, who is originally from Italy, and moved to USA about 10 or 12 years ago, is a very serious and devoted Doberman afficionado. He breeds beautiful, truly elegant and bright and incredible temperament dogs. He shows all over the world, and he is a respected Doberman judge. He does confirmation, as well as Schutzhund. He has an amazing eye for Doberman structure.
In my opinion, he was a bit old-fashioned in his attitude about full disclosure of health issues, and perhaps this has changed. He poo-poo'ed our requests for health test results, and since we really loved his dogs, and he seemed so sincere and indignant that we would question his integrity, that we went forward with getting pupies from him - twice. I don't see any current info on new litters. Our dogs are all vWD carriers, and 3 of them have significant clotting issues, though not full-blown von Willebrands. Alex died of dilated cardiomyopathy at age 6. In this day and age, with DNA testing so readily available, and the true potential to virtually wipe many genetic disorders out once and for all (maybe not totally realistic, but certainly theoretically, through responsible pairings), one would think that any true devotee and champion of our wonderful breed - (or any breed, or humans, for that matter!) would do whatever they could to avoid pairings that link 2 carriers of a condition - no matter how beautiful they might be together - - - the betterment of the breed is NOT just confirmation, but health, longevity, temperament, personality and intelligence. While we still just drool over Roberto's artistic eye, we have come to feel very strongly that frank, open, proactive communication between breeders and potential buyers is mandatory. I want to know how long the grandparents and greatgrandparents lived! I wanted my Alex around for at least 6 or 8 more years - and I know for sure that he wanted the same thing! Breeding dogs that will only have a 5 or 6 year life span is, to me, not OK. Lois

I think the thing with Ray CArlisle is consistency. Not only does Ray produce a lot of nice working dogs, that are generally healthy and fairly good looking, he produces them consistently. Bear in mind he is not the only breeder in the U.S. to do this, but he certainly does stand out in everybody's mind.
